Underground power supply mooted

Vizag city will be relieved from power woes if traditional electricity be converted into underground cable
Visakhapatnam: Vizag city will be relieved from power woes if the plans for converting traditional electricity network to underground cable system materialise.The state government had submitted proposal to the World Bank to provide underground power cable system to the Port City. Secretary of Energy department Ajay Jain said that they had forwarded the initial proposal to the WB on October 6 with Rs500 crore and would prepare a detailed keeping the disaster view.
As coastal AP is prone to frequent cyclones and natural calamities, both the state and Central governments have realised the need for underground power cables to minimise the damages. The recent havoc also stressed the need of such cable system.
The National Disaster Management Authority earlier proposed to replace overhead cables of about 1,000 km along the coast in AP with underground cables to reduce the damages.
The EPDCL suffered sev-ere damages during the r-ecent three cyclones, Phai-lin, Helen and Hudhud.
Now, the government is planning to arrange unde-rground cable network in Vizag city where traditional electricity network, of which roughly 80 per cent has been damaged.
Mr Jain said power transmission lines in North Andhra districts received damages to the tune of Rs1,000 crore. He also said the Prime Minister promised that the city would be provided necessary assistance as part of measures making it a Smart City.
